Obsidian Entertainment Trademarks “The Outer Worlds”

A certain eagle-eyed Obsidian forums user who goes by UrbaNebula spotted a number of Obsidian Entertainment trademarks for something called The Outer Worlds. I say something, because these trademarks cover a broad range of entertainment products, from video games and online services to board games and comic books. The leading theory right now is that this may be the working title of Tim Cain and Leonard Boyarsky's mysterious Project Indiana but we can't be certain of that just yet.
